Role-Based Access Control (RBAC) plays a crucial role in enhancing security measures within proxy server environments. RBAC is a method of access control that restricts network access based on the roles assigned to users. By implementing RBAC, organizations can effectively manage permissions, user roles, and authorization levels, thereby ensuring a secure and controlled network environment.
Proxy servers are commonly used to regulate and monitor internet access, making RBAC an essential component for strengthening security protocols. By leveraging RBAC in proxy server settings, businesses can enforce stringent access controls, minimize the risks of unauthorized access, and enhance data protection.
123Proxy, a leading provider of Rotating Residential Proxies with Unlimited Traffic, ensures seamless integration of RBAC for proxy server security. With a robust network infrastructure and advanced security features, 123Proxy’s Rotating Proxies offer unparalleled protection against unauthorized access attempts and ensure secure data transmission.
Understanding Role-Based Access Control (RBAC)
Definition and purpose of RBAC
Role-Based Access Control (RBAC) is a method of controlling system access based on roles assigned to users within an organization. It sets permissions according to the user roles and permissions assigned, ensuring secure access control.
Benefits of implementing RBAC
Implementing RBAC provides organizations with a structured approach to managing user permissions and access rights. It simplifies user management, reduces the risk of unauthorized access, and enhances overall security.
Importance of RBAC in proxy server security
RBAC plays a crucial role in proxy server security by restricting access to only authorized users. It ensures that users have the necessary permissions to access specific websites through the proxy server, enhancing security and data protection.
Implementing RBAC in Proxy Server Environments
Steps to set up RBAC for proxy servers
Implementing Role-Based Access Control (RBAC) in proxy server environments is crucial for ensuring secure access control and preventing unauthorized access to websites. Follow these steps to set up RBAC effectively:
- Identify the different user roles within your organization, such as administrators, users, and guests.
- Define the permissions and access levels that each role should have when using the proxy server.
- Create role profiles that outline the specific permissions assigned to each role.
- Implement RBAC policies that enforce these role profiles and permissions.
Role assignment and permission allocation
Once you have set up RBAC in your proxy server environment, the next step is to assign roles and allocate permissions to users. This process involves:
- Assigning specific roles to individual users based on their job responsibilities and access needs.
- Granting permissions to each role according to the defined role profiles.
- Regularly reviewing and updating role assignments and permissions to align with changes in the organization.
Monitoring user activities with RBAC
RBAC not only helps in setting up access control but also enables monitoring and auditing user activities within the proxy server environment. By implementing RBAC, you can:
- Track user login attempts and access requests to identify any suspicious activities.
- Generate reports on user actions and permissions changes for security compliance purposes.
- Detect and mitigate any unauthorized access attempts or suspicious behavior by users.
- Enhance overall security measures by having visibility into user activities and access patterns.
Role-Based Control for Secure Access
Restricting access to authorized users
Role-Based Access Control (RBAC) is a crucial method for controlling system access based on roles assigned to users within an organization. By implementing RBAC in proxy server security, access to sensitive data and websites can be restricted to only authorized personnel. This helps in preventing unauthorized users from gaining entry, thereby enhancing security and minimizing potential risks.
Data protection and security measures
RBAC plays a significant role in data protection and security measures within a proxy server environment. By defining user roles and permissions, organizations can ensure that confidential data is accessed only by individuals with the necessary authorization. This not only safeguards sensitive information but also reduces the chances of data breaches and cyber threats.
Ensuring compliance with RBAC policies
Adhering to RBAC policies is essential for maintaining a secure proxy server environment. By strictly enforcing role-based access control measures, organizations can ensure compliance with industry regulations and best practices. This helps in enhancing network security, establishing clear user permissions, and maintaining an efficient access control system.
RBAC Best Practices for Proxy Server Security
Regular Audits and Review of User Roles
Role-based access control (RBAC) is crucial for maintaining proxy server security. Regular audits and reviews of user roles help ensure that the right permissions are assigned to the right individuals. By regularly monitoring and updating user roles, organizations can prevent unauthorized access and potential security breaches.
Revoking Access When Necessary
It’s important to promptly revoke access when it is no longer needed or when users change roles within the organization. By revoking access when necessary, organizations can minimize the risk of data leaks and unauthorized access to sensitive information.
Training and Educating Users on RBAC Usage
Proper training and education on RBAC usage are essential for maximizing the security benefits of role-based access control in proxy server environments. Users should be educated on how to effectively use RBAC permissions, understand the importance of secure access control, and be aware of best practices to follow to maintain a secure proxy server environment.
Challenges of Implementing RBAC in Proxy Servers
Scalability issues with a large user base
Implementing Role-Based Access Control (RBAC) in proxy servers can encounter scalability issues when there is a large user base within an organization. Managing and assigning roles and permissions to a vast number of users may become challenging, requiring robust systems and processes to handle the load efficiently.
User resistance to new access control measures
One of the challenges of implementing RBAC in proxy servers is user resistance to new access control measures. Users may be accustomed to a certain level of access and restrictions, making it challenging to introduce changes that come with RBAC. Proper communication and training are essential to overcome this resistance.
Integration of RBAC with existing security systems
Integrating RBAC with existing security systems can be a complex task. Proxy servers may already have established security measures in place, and ensuring seamless integration with RBAC without compromising security is crucial. Compatibility issues and potential conflicts need to be carefully addressed during the integration process.
RBAC and Proxy Server Performance
Impact of RBAC on proxy server speed
Role-Based Access Control (RBAC) plays a crucial role in ensuring the security of proxy servers. While implementing RBAC can enhance security measures, it is essential to consider its impact on proxy server speed. RBAC adds an additional layer of authentication and authorization, which can potentially affect the processing time of each request. However, with efficient RBAC settings and proper configuration, the impact on proxy server speed can be minimized.
Optimizing RBAC settings for efficiency
To optimize RBAC settings for efficiency, administrators can fine-tune the roles and permissions assigned to users. By carefully defining role-based access controls and setting granular permissions, unnecessary delays in proxy server performance can be avoided. Regular assessments and adjustments to RBAC settings can help maintain a balance between security requirements and system efficiency.
Balancing security needs with performance considerations
When it comes to balancing security needs with performance considerations, organizations must strike a delicate balance. While robust security measures are crucial for protecting sensitive data and preventing unauthorized access, excessively strict RBAC settings can impact proxy server performance. It is important to evaluate the specific security requirements of the organization and adjust RBAC settings accordingly to ensure optimal performance without compromising security.
Role-Based Access Control for Proxy Server Security Summary
Role-Based Access Control (RBAC) plays a crucial role in managing system access by assigning roles to users within an organization. By setting permissions based on user roles, RBAC helps restrict access to authorized users, enhancing security and data protection in proxy server environments. It ensures strict control over user permissions and activities, promoting secure access control. Implementing RBAC is vital for safeguarding proxy servers against unauthorized access and potential threats.
Rotating Proxies
Reference: Authorization using Role-Based Access Control
Reference: Access Control with Reverse Proxy – miniOrange
Reference: role-based access control (RBAC) – TechTarget